⚡ Why Coastal Properties Are More Vulnerable
- Frequent Thunderstorms
Coastal Louisiana sees frequent and intense thunderstorms, especially during summer and hurricane season.
- Flat Terrain & Open Land
Lightning is more likely to strike:
- Homes on open lots
- Farms and barns
- Waterfront properties
- High Humidity
Moist air increases electrical conductivity, contributing to more lightning activity.

🛡️ How Lightning Rods Protect Your Property
A lightning protection system works by:
- Intercepting lightning with air terminals (rods)
- Safely carrying energy through conductors
- Dispersing it into the ground via a grounding system
Instead of passing through your home or building, lightning is controlled and redirected safely.
